A leading commercial real estate firm is seeking a Commercial Property Manager to oversee a diverse portfolio of properties in the Dallas area. This role is ideal for a results-driven professional with a strong background in property operations, financial oversight, and tenant relations.

Position Goals:

  • Align property performance with ownership objectives
  • Ensure consistent lease compliance and cost control
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with tenants, vendors, and property owners

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and manage annual budgets for multiple commercial properties
  • Review and interpret monthly financial reports to ensure financial targets are met
  • Act as the main point of contact for property-related issues from both tenants and owners
  • Collaborate with legal teams on lease interpretation, evictions, and lockouts
  • Monitor and enforce lease terms and obligations
  • Coordinate and supervise vendor services to ensure quality and cost-effectiveness
  • Oversee maintenance needs and identify capital improvement opportunities
  • Manage bidding and execution of tenant improvement projects
  • Conduct regular property inspections to maintain high standards
  • Oversee annual bidding processes for recurring contracts
  • Supervise and support property management assistants
  • Collaborate with internal teams to enhance service delivery and client satisfaction
  • Respond promptly to client and team inquiries
  • Maintain confidentiality and represent the company with professionalism
  • Support team objectives and take on related responsibilities as needed

Required Skills & Experience:

  • Bachelor’s degree from an accredited institution (minimum 3.0 GPA)
  • 3–5 years of property management experience required (COMMERCIAL IS REQUIRED)
  • Solid knowledge of budgeting, CAM reconciliations, and lease management
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int)
  • Experience with Yardi Voyager is a strong plus
  • Strong organizational and time management skills
  • Excellent written and verbal communication abilities
  • Customer-focused with a proactive approach to problem-solving
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ment

Physical Requirements:

  • Frequent use of computer and phone (5–6 hours/day)
  • Sitting: 5–6 hours/day; Standing: 1–2 hours/day
  • Occasional lifting (up to 25 lbs)
  • Regular property site visits and inspections
  • Adequate vision for office work and property assessments
